Turkey death toll from earthquake climbs to 1,121 -disaster agency
ISTANBUL, Feb 6 (Reuters) - The death toll rose to 1,121 from a major earthquake that shook Turkey's south early on Monday, and a total 7,634 people have been injured, an official from the disaster and emergencies management agency (AFAD) said. Orhan Tatar, head of the AFAD department handling earthquake risks, told a media briefing that 2,834 buildings have been destroyed in the quake and the subsequent tremors centred on Kahramanmaras province, noting there had been 120 aftershocks.
